Tips for Practicing

Practice Tips

Learning to play "Just A Friend To You" on the guitar takes practice and dedication. Here are some tips to help you improve:

  • Start slow: Begin by practicing the chords slowly and gradually increase the tempo as you become more comfortable with the song.
  • Focus on technique: Pay attention to your hand placement and finger positioning, especially as you switch between chords.
  • Practice with a metronome: Using a metronome can help you stay on beat and improve your timing.
  • Record yourself: Listening to a recording of yourself playing the song can help you identify areas where you need to improve.
